IRA Distribution
I contributed $5500 to a Roth IRA in 2019 (for 2019). In 2020 when doing taxes for 2019, our tax professional told us we had too high of a gross income in 2019, so we couldn't contribute to a Roth IRA. I filed a removal of excess form with the investment company and had the money taken out. I now have received a 1099-R form from that company. On my tax filing it shows that I did not contribute to my Roth IRA in 2019. Do I need to amend my 2019 tax form?
